2017-06-21 8 views
0

Ich hoffe, das ist etwas wirklich einfaches, dass ich vermisse. Ich habe zwei Seiten auf einer Seite, die auf einer Seite fast identisch sind. Beide enthalten ein Formularelement und einige Überschriften und Absätze, die alle in einem div mit flex display enthalten sind.Blockelemente seltsam verhalten

Auf der einen Seite die h2, p und h3-Elemente verhalten sich wie erwartet (dh als Blockelemente) Here is a link to this page

Die andere Seite ist Setup genau die gleiche Art und Weise (soweit ich sehen kann), aber die h2 , h3 und p-Elemente verhalten sich wie Inline-Elemente. Link to other page

Was ist los? Vielen Dank.

Antwort

1

Auf der ersten Seite <p> Tag Inhalt ist schwer, so dass es Block zeigt, wenn Sie versuchen, mit der zweiten Seite <p> Tag contentent schwer es in der nächsten Zeile zeigt.

Es ist wie Beacause der Elternklasse flex_div_container hat flex Propery. Also jedes Element in der Seite, die div verhalten sich wie inline-block

+0

@egd Got my point –

+0

Ah ha! Danke, ich habe etwas zusätzlichen Text hinzugefügt, der es sortiert zu haben scheint. Danke für die Hilfe. – egd

+0

@egd Willkommen ... –